Investigations on quality characteristics in gas tungsten arc welding process using artificial neural network integrated with genetic algorithm

Abstract: Gas tungsten arc welding (GTAW) technology is widely used in industry and has advantages, including high precision, excellent welding quality, and low equipment cost. However, the inclusion of a large number of process parameters hinders its application on a wider scale. Therefore, there is a need to implement the prediction and optimization models that effectively enhance the process performance of the GTAW process in different applications. “…They also presented the prediction of the bead geometry using BPNN-PSO as combined BPNN and PSO is similar to the experimental geometry. Tomaz et al [9] proposed the welding parameter optimization for the gas tungsten arc welding (GTAW) process using the AISI 1020 plate and UTP AF Ledurit 60, 68 wire. They built a database by analyzing the correlations between process parameters, such as welding current, welding speed, nozzle stand-off distance, travel angle, and wire feed pulse frequency, and output parameters, such as reinforcement, penetration, bead width, and dilution.…”
